Suspect in deadly Texas Chick-fil-A shooting in U.S. illegally, ICE confirms –Irving PD identified suspect Oved Bernardo Mendoza Argueta, 37, as having an ‘ICE hold’ | 27 June 2024 | Authorities say the suspect in a deadly Texas shooting that killed two people inside a fast-food restaurant is in custody, and that he is in the United States illegally. Oved Bernardo Mendoza Argueta, a 37-year-old citizen of El Salvador, is charged with capital murder of multiple persons after a shooting Wednesday at a Chick-fil-A in the 5300 block of North MacArthur Boulevard in Irving, police announced. “We can confirm that the suspect was taken into custody early this morning,” a spokesperson for Irving Police Department told Fox News Digital on Thursday morning, adding that Mendoza Argueta has an “ICE hold,” with the warrant agency being Immigration and Naturalization Service Dallas/Fort Worth.
